U.S. Marines with Marine Fighter Attack Squadron 121, Marine Aircraft Group 12, 1st Marine Aircraft Wing, U.S. Airmen with 25th Fighter Squadron, 35th Fighter Squadron and Republic of Korea (ROK) Airmen with the 11th Fighter Wing, 20th Fighter Wing, 10th Fighter Wing, and 19th Fighter Wing continue to perform scheduled flight operations in support of Korea Flying Training (KFT) 24 at Kunsan Air Base, South Korea, April 25, 2024. KFT 24 is a large-scale employment training exercise enhancing U.S. and ROK interoperability and ultimately strengthening U.S. and ROK commitments to maintain peace in the region.
